🧾 Ingredients:
- 1 lb ground beef
- 4 oz Smokin’ Ts Original or With a Kick
- ½ small to medium sweet onion, finely diced
- 1 button mushroom, finely diced
- 4 oz Wisconsin cheddar cheese, diced
- 8 slices Wisconsin cheddar cheese (for topping)
- 1 tsp minced garlic (or ¼ tsp garlic powder)
- ½ tsp salt
- ¼ tsp pepper
- Burger buns and your favorite toppings (lettuce, tomato, pickles, etc.)
👩🍳 Instructions:
- Prep the mix-ins:
Finely dice the onion, mushroom, and cheddar (if using block cheese). - Mix the patties:
In a large bowl, combine ground beef, diced onion, mushroom, cheddar, garlic, salt, pepper, and Smokin’ Ts sauce. Mix just until combined—don’t overwork it. - Shape the patties:
Form into 4 large burger patties or 6 smaller ones. Press a slight indent into the center of each patty to help them cook evenly. - Cook the burgers:
Grill or pan-fry over medium-high heat for 3–4 minutes per side, or until the internal temp hits 160°F. In the last minute of cooking, top with a slice of cheddar and cover loosely to melt. - Build the burgers:
Toast the buns and layer with lettuce, tomato, onion, and pickles. Add your cheesy Smokin’ Ts patty, then drizzle with a little extra sauce for good measure.
🔥 Why It Works:
Smokin’ Ts sauce doesn’t just sit on top—it’s built right into the burger. This means every bite is juicy, smoky, and cheesy. The onion and mushroom add moisture and umami, while the cheese melts into the patty for a gooey interior surprise.
